Because of the way locals were dying in the area, Gleib was accused of vampirism, and fell to his death after some old-fashioned … Dwight Iliff Frye (born Fry; February 22, 1899 – November 7, 1943) was an American character actor of stage and screen. He is best known for his portrayals of neurotic, murderous villains in several classic Universal horror films, such as Renfield in Dracula (1931) and Fritz in Frankenstein (1931). See more Early life and career Frye was born in Salina, Kansas, and studied for a career in music and first appeared as a concert pianist. WebWhen the villagers of Kleinschloss start dying of blood loss, the town fathers suspect a resurgence of vampirism. While police inspector Karl Brettschneider remains skeptical, scientist Dr. Otto von Niemann cares for the vampire’s victims one by one, and suspicion falls on simple-minded Herman Gleib because of his fondness for bats.
